Kristen Finch is the Director of Research Computing Solutions at the University of Washington, where she leads a team supporting researchers with high-performance computing (HPC), cloud solutions, and data storage. With a PhD from Oregon State University, her background spans over a decade in conservation genetics and bioinformatics, which informs her current work.
During her time at Oregon State, she was the host of a campus radio talk show called "Inspiration Dissemination, " which featured the research and personal stories of graduate students. She also hosted a podcast called "Calm AF" (previously "Show Up and Love").
Her research in conservation genetics has practical applications, including developing tools to help enforce timber trade regulations for protected tree species.
